Top definition
widely used in Britain and the UK; means simply 'a kiss'.
Do you fancy a snogg?
by kerrigwen July 13, 2005
Get the mug
Get a snogg mug for your friend Rihanna.
British word basically meaning In American terms a make out session
“Omg did you see Emily snogging Adam last night”
“Hey Harvey ya gonna snog Lucie tonight?”
by Brendon's forehead September 27, 2018
Get the mug
Get a Snogg mug for your sister Beatrix.